Title: Innovations of Thomas Worzyk
Introduction
Thomas Worzyk is a notable inventor based in Lyckeby, Sweden. He has made significant contributions to the field of electrical engineering, particularly in power cable technology. With a total of four patents to his name, Worzyk's work reflects his commitment to advancing industry standards and improving safety measures.
Latest Patents
Worzyk's latest patents include a "Power Cable Measurement System" and a "Bend Stiffener with Bend Indication." The power cable measurement system is designed to facilitate measurements of a power cable terminated at an electrical substation and connected to an overhead busbar. This system features a first movable structure equipped with a busbar connector and a measurement equipment connector device. The movable structure can be maneuvered between a default lowered position and a temporary elevated position, allowing for electrical connection with the overhead busbar.
The bend stiffener patent includes a body that tapers from a base to a top, featuring a central through-opening for receiving a subsea cable or umbilical. It also incorporates a bend indicator that visually indicates the bend status of the stiffener, enhancing safety and operational efficiency.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Thomas Worzyk has worked with prominent companies such as ABB HV Cables (Switzerland) GmbH and ABB Technology Ltd.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to develop and refine his innovative ideas, contributing to the advancement of electrical engineering technologies.
